Text

1.Every application for an instruction permit shall be made upon a form furnished by the director, which application shall be certified by the applicant to be true and correct, and every such application shall be accompanied by a fee of one dollar.
2.In addition to the fee prescribed in subsection 1 of this section, applicants for a motorcycle instruction permit under section 302.132 shall pay a special motorcycle safety education fee of two dollars and seventy-five cents.

Legislative History

(RSMo 1939 § 8449, A.L. 1951 p. 678, A.L. 1984 H.B. 1045, A.L. 1986 H.B. 1153, A.L. 1995 H.B. 717)
